How to Reset Firestick Without Remote Control: 5 Easy Methods

If you own a Firestick, you know how convenient it is to stream your favorite shows, movies, and music on your TV. But what if you lose or break your Firestick remote control? How can you reset your Firestick without a remote control?

Resetting your Firestick can solve many problems, such as low storage, slow performance, or a frozen screen. However, it also means wiping out all your data and settings, so you will need to set up your device again after the reset.

Method 1: Using the Fire TV app on your smartphone

One of the easiest ways to reset your Firestick without a remote is to use the Fire TV app on your smartphone. This app lets you control your Firestick with your phone as long as they are connected to the same Wi-Fi network.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Download the Fire TV app on your smartphone from the Google Play Store or the App Store.
  2. Launch the app and select your Firestick device from the list.
  3. Tap on the Settings icon on the top right corner of the app.
  4. Select My Fire TV from the menu.
  5. Scroll down and select Reset to Factory Defaults.
  6. Confirm your choice by tapping on Reset.

Your Firestick will now start resetting and rebooting. After that, you will need to set up your device again using a physical remote.

Method 2: Using HDMI-CEC on your TV

Another way to reset your Firestick without a remote is to use HDMI-CEC on your TV. HDMI-CEC is a feature that allows you to control multiple devices with one remote through the HDMI port. If your TV supports this feature, you can use your TV remote to control your Firestick and reset it.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Turn on your TV and switch to the HDMI input where your Firestick is connected.
  2. Grab your TV remote and press the Menu button.
  3. Navigate to the Settings or System menu of your TV.
  4. Look for an option called HDMI-CEC, CEC, Anynet+, Bravia Sync, or something similar, depending on your TV brand.
  5. Enable this option and exit the menu.
  6. Now use your TV remote to navigate to the Settings menu of your Firestick.
  7. Select Device or My Fire TV from the menu.
  8. Select Reset to Factory Defaults and confirm by selecting Reset.

Your Firestick will now start resetting and rebooting. After that, you will need to set up your device again using a physical remote.

Method 3: Using a wireless keyboard

If you have a wireless keyboard that is compatible with your Firestick, you can use it to reset your device without a remote. You will need to pair the keyboard with your Firestick first before you can use it.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Plug in the USB receiver of your wireless keyboard into one of the USB ports of your Firestick or an adapter if needed.
  2. Turn on your keyboard and wait for it to pair with your Firestick.
  3. Use the arrow keys and Enter key on your keyboard to navigate to the Settings menu of your Firestick.
  4. Select Device or My Fire TV from the menu.
  5. Select Reset to Factory Defaults and confirm by pressing Enter.

Your Firestick will now start resetting and rebooting. After that, you will need to set up your device again using a physical remote.

Method 5: Using ADB on your computer

ADB (Android Debug Bridge) is a tool that allows you to communicate with Android devices from your computer via USB or Wi-Fi. You can use ADB to reset your Firestick without a remote, but you will need to enable debugging on your device and install ADB on your computer first.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Enable debugging on your Firestick by going to Settings > Device or My Fire TV > Developer Options > ADB Debugging > On.
  2. Install ADB on your computer by following the instructions here: https://developer.amazon.com/docs/fire-tv/connecting-adb-to-device.html
  3. Connect your Firestick to your computer via USB or Wi-Fi. To connect via Wi-Fi, you will need to find the IP address of your Firestick by going to Settings > Device or My Fire TV > About > Network.
  4. Open a terminal or command prompt on your computer and type adb devices to check if your Firestick is detected. You should see a list of devices with their serial numbers.
  5. Type adb shell and press Enter to enter the shell mode of your Firestick.
  6. Type recovery –wipe_data and press Enter to reset your Firestick.

Your Firestick will now start resetting and rebooting. After that, you will need to set up your device again using a physical remote.

FAQs


Q: How do I set up my Firestick after resetting it?

A: To set up your Firestick after resetting it, you will need a physical remote and a Wi-Fi connection. Follow the on-screen instructions to select your language, connect to Wi-Fi, sign in to your Amazon account, and download apps.

Q: How do I get a replacement remote for my Firestick?

A: You can order a replacement remote for your Firestick from Amazon or other online retailers. Make sure you choose the right model for your device. You can also use the Fire TV app on your smartphone as a remote.

Q: How do I prevent my Firestick from having issues in the future?

A: To prevent your Firestick from having issues in the future, you can do the following:

  • Keep your device updated with the latest software version.
  • Clear the cache and data of apps that are not working properly or taking up too much space.
  • Uninstall apps that you don’t use or need.
  • Restart your device regularly to clear the memory and improve performance.
  • Avoid using VPNs or proxies that may interfere with the streaming quality or content availability.
